          That is awesome archie! Eddie certainly was the man back then. I have to tell you a story. I grew up on bmx all day long. In the early 80's my quest was an all white bike, but i was held back by the lack of white tires.They did not exist. The GT freestyle team came to the incomparable Rockville BMX and i was stunned to see Eddies bike with WHITE tires. My 13 year old brain could not absorb this information and i remember just standing there shaking and not knowing what to do. I talked to Eddie after the show and BEGGED him to sell me a used pair. Turns out they were prototypes and only 3 or 4 pairs existed in the world, Eddie was testing the compound to see if they would hold up. They would not be available to the public for months. After more pleading and showing him my almost all white GT he told me to come back tomorrow (2 day show) and he would sell me a worn set after the show. I could not fucking sleep that night. Eddie signed the sidewalls and i rocked those tires til they were only threads.
